## v0.9.3 — Metrics Sidecar

The Corvane metrics-aggregation sidecar now flushes every 15s instead of 60s and drops malformed gauge lines rather than blocking the pipe. Memory ceiling raised to 256MB. On-call: if the sidecar restarts more than twice per hour, roll back to 0.9.2 and page the owner listed below.

account owner for kafop-haweg: Pelax Gilael Istir

- [ ] Step 7: Archive cold storage buckets (Glacierline tier). Confirm both ceremony witnesses are present, verify bucket manifests match the Oxbow ledger, then seal the archive key shares. Plugin authors may observe but not handle shares. Once sealed, the archive index itself is encrypted and can only be reopened with the passphrase below.

vault phrase of badup-hahig = tamael-aldael-kelmir-istael-fenok-istwyn-tamius-jorath-oliion

# Provenance — DeployBot status bot

New contractors: DeployBot builds come only from the Fernlake pipeline. No local builds get deployed, ever. Each artifact carries a signed manifest linking it to a commit and pipeline run. Before promoting anything, check the manifest signature and confirm the pipeline run is green. Tampered or unsigned artifacts get quarantined automatically. The current release's provenance token is listed below.

session token of tajef-bageg = htk21_5d90d574934f3ccae6437